PNW PGA Honored for Growing Junior Golf Through PGA JLG

pga-jlg-flagPALM BEACH GARDENS, Fla. – The PGA of America and League Golf will honor eight regional PGA Junior League Golf Captains and PGA Sections of the Year for their successful 2014 seasons during the 62nd PGA Merchandise Show. The national PGA Junior League Golf Captain and PGA Section of the Year will be named Jan. 21 (Wednesday) during the “Growing Junior Golf Through PGA Junior League Golf” presentation (2:30 – 3:15 p.m.) on the PGA Forum Stage.

“Our Professionals and PGA Section honorees have truly put in the time, energy and passion to cultivate PGA Junior League Golf participants across the country,” said PGA of America President Derek Sprague. “Thanks to their efforts, boys and girls nationwide are being introduced to golf and ensuring the future of the game.”

The regional PGA Sections of the Year honorees were selected based on the total number of teams, percentage increase in teams from 2013, percentage of PGA facilities participating and their overall involvement in PGA Junior League Golf promotion, recruitment, league assignments and communication.

Each of the eight regional PGA Junior League Golf Sections of the Year saw significant increases in team participation in 2014. Below are the regional winners and their percentage increases from 2013 to 2014:

Region 1 – New England PGA Section

  • 85 teams, 74% increase

Region 2 – Mid-Atlantic PGA Section

  • 115 teams, 80% increase

Region 3 – Indiana PGA Section

  • 98 teams, 63% increase

Region 4 – Illinois PGA Section

  • 124 teams, 126% increase

Region 5 – Carolinas PGA Section

  • 105 teams, 135% increase

Region 6 – Georgia PGA Section

  • 86 teams, 56% increase

Region 7 – Gateway PGA Section

  • 47 teams, 840% increase

Region 8 – Pacific Northwest PGA Section

  • 62 teams, 265% increase

The regional Captains of the Year were selected based upon various criteria, including player participation, recruitment of PGA Professional Captains, parental involvement and other administrative duties associated with running their leagues.

The 2014 PGA Junior League Golf regional Captains of the Year with their achievements are:

  • Region 1 – Todd Cook, PGA: Milton Hoosic Club (Canton, Mass.)
  • Region 2 – Andy Miller, PGA: Berkshire Country Club (Reading, Pa.)
  • Region 3 – Scott Jones, PGA: Turnberry Golf Course (Pickerington, Ohio)
  • Region 4 – Todd Russell, PGA: Springbrook Golf Club (Naperville, Ill.)
  • Region 5 – Ralph Landrum, PGA: World of Golf (Florence, Ky.)
  • Region 6 – Jack Dean, PGA: Dublin, Ga.
  • Region 7 – Nic Bunning, PGA: Greenbriar Hills Country Club (Kirkwood, Mo.)
  • Region 8 – Nolan Halterman, PGA: Anthem Country Club (Henderson, Nev.)
